Chapter 52 of the GST framework covers Cotton, and HSN Code 52051410 specifically identifies Cotton Yarn (Other Than Sewing Thread), Containing 85% Or More By Weight Of Cotton, Not Put Up For Retail Sale - Single Yarn, Of Uncombed Fibres : Measuring Less Than 192.31 Decitex But Not Less Than 125 Decitex (Exceeding 52 Metric Number But Not Exceed... for taxation purposes. This classification is mandatory for all businesses engaged in the supply of Cotton Yarn (Other Than Sewing Thread), Containing 85% Or More By Weight Of Cotton, Not Put Up For Retail Sale - Single Yarn, Of Uncombed Fibres : Measuring Less Than 192.31 Decitex But Not Less Than 125 Decitex (Exceeding 52 Metric Number But Not Exceed.... Tax rates applicable include CGST at 2.50%, SGST/UTGST at 2.50%, and IGST at 5.00% for interstate movements. The standard unit of measurement is kg..

What is the difference between CGST and IGST for HSN 52051410?

CGST at 2.50% plus SGST/UTGST at 2.50% applies when Cotton Yarn (Other Than Sewing Thread), Containing 85% Or More By Weight Of Cotton, Not Put Up For Retail Sale - Single Yarn, Of Uncombed Fibres : Measuring Less Than 192.31 Decitex But Not Less Than 125 Decitex (Exceeding 52 Metric Number But Not Exceed... is sold within the same state. IGST at 5.00% is charged when goods move across state borders or are imported.
